American Water's sustainability principles include:
- Financial: We drive financial sustainability through disciplined capital investment and regulatory execution, supporting business growth and long-term shareholder value. Our capital program is funded by operating cash flow and a balanced mix of debt and equity issuances structured to maintain a healthy balance sheet.
- Operational: We focus on delivering safe, clean, reliable and affordable water and wastewater services through efficient, compliant operations. Our commitment to safety, performance and environmental standards aligns with the values of regulators and policymakers.
- Cultural: We foster a high-performing workforce by attracting and retaining employees who share our purpose and values. Investing in our people drives innovation, operational improvement and quality service for our customers and communities.
American Water prepared the Sustainability Report by applying standards from the Global Reporting Initiative, Sustainability Accounting Standards Board, and the Task Force on Climate-Related Financial Disclosures. The report also takes into consideration the United Nations Sustainable Development Goals and aligns with the company's responses to the CDP Questionnaire.

About American Water
American Water (NYSE: AWK) is the largest regulated water and wastewater utility company in the United States. With a history dating back to 1886 and celebrating 140 years in 2026, We Keep Life Flowing® by providing safe, clean, reliable and affordable drinking water and wastewater services to approximately 14 million people with regulated operations in 14 states and on 18 military installations. American Water's approximately 7,000 talented professionals leverage their significant expertise and the company's national size and scale to achieve excellent outcomes for the benefit of customers, employees, investors and other stakeholders.
